ZIP Code 33023: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 33023?
The median home value in ZIP Code 33023 is $380,000, higher than 79%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 33023?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 33023 is $3,137,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 33023 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 33023 cost about 5.09× the median household income, higher than 86%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 33023?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 33023 is $1,750 a month, higher than 89%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 33023?
Home prices in ZIP Code 33023 have moved 69% over the past five years (3.1%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 33023?
ZIP Code 33023 averages 77.3°F year-round, summer highs near 91.2°F, winter lows around 61.3°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als).
Is ZIP Code 33023 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 33023's FEMA National Risk Index score is 46.2 (lower than 71%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is hurricane.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
